HGM 400N series genset controllers integrate digitization, intelligence and network technology used for genset automation and single unit monitor control system to achieve automatic start/stop, data metering, alarm protection and «three remotes» (remote control, remote metering and remote communication; SG485 module must be installed). It is fitted with LCD display, optional language interface (Chinese, English, Spanish, Turkish, Russian and French), and is reliable and easy to use.
HGM400N series genset controllers adopt microprocessor technology with precision parameters measuring, fixed value setting, time setting and setting value setting and etc. All parameters can be configured from the front panel or via the USB interface using a PC.
It can be widely used in all kinds of automatic genset control system with compact structure, advanced circuits, simple connections and high reliability. PERFORMANCE AND FEATURES: HGM400N series controller has two types: HGM410N: ASM (automatic start module), controls generator to start/stop by remote signal; HGM420N: AMF (automatic mains error), upgrades based on HGM410N, in addition, it has mains and mains and mains and automatic mains electric quantity control, generator transfer control function, especially for automatic system composed of generator and mains.1. 132×64 LCD with backlight, selectable language interface (Chinese, English, Spanish, Turkish, Russian and French), push-button operation; 2.
Improved LCD wear resistance and scratch resistance due to hard screen acrylic; 3. Silicon panel and push buttons for better operation in high and low temperature environment; 4. Suitable for three-phase 4-wire, three-phase 3-wire, single-phase 2-wire and 2-phase 3-wire systems with voltage 120/240V and frequency 50/60Hz;5. Collects and displays three-phase voltage, current, power parameter and generator or mains frequency. 6.
